JOB REQUIREMENTS: Water TreatmentTechnical Service Rep. is responsiblefor providing technical/troubleshooting assistance, generalproductinformation, warranty assistance, and limited parts order processing onproduct that requires extensiveproduct knowledge. Their primarycustomers are wholesalers (Plumbing and Pump and Well), plumbers,welldriller/pump installers, water treatment professionals, generalcontractors, service professionals, facilitymaintenance personnel,architects, engineers and other professionals responsible for ensuringequipment isspecified and serviced properly. Water Treatment TechnicalService Rep. also works to assist callers to repairexisting equipment orreplace equipment when needed. Responsibilities Often serves as the maincontact to our company for water treatment questions andequipmentinformation. Receives calls about treatment equipment andtechniques. Providing water analysis interpretation and productrecommendation. Trouble shoot equipment problems in the field and directproper repair procedures recommendingparts. Assist with sizing watertreatment based on facility size and water usage. Assisting withinstallationprocedures. Referring homeowners and potential customers todealers and distributors for water treatment salesand service. Quotespecific commercial/industrial water treatment equipment utilizingengineered drawings andspecs provided by customers. Perform audits andmodifications when needed on bill of materials for equipment builds.Perform quality control functions and programming inspections on allcommercial and industrialequipment before it leaves Water-Right. Workinternally on product improvement and advancement of new and existingproducts. Test and vet out issues that are identified either internallyor through feedback of dealers and distributors. Provide technical datato internal Marketing Department for literature, and spec sheets onequipment. Provide specifications of equipment to caller inquiries.Check availability of parts for dealers and distributors to assist inorder entry. Other responsibilities may be assigned as necessary.Qualifications Assoicate Degree in related field preferred 3+ years ofrelated work experience or training (mechanical aptitude in lieu ofwater treatment) Experience in installation, sizing, repair,troubleshooting. (Mechanical products) Water chemistry knowledge orbackground a plus, not required. Pump and well knowledge a plus,notrequired.
